Kursdetails

โ€ข Introduction to Genetic Nanomedicine Innovations: Overview of the field, including history, current state, and future potential.
โ€ข Fundamentals of Nanotechnology: Study of nanomaterials, nanoparticles, and their unique properties.
โ€ข Genetic Engineering Basics: Examination of DNA, RNA, and gene editing techniques like CRISPR-Cas9.
โ€ข Designing Nanomedicines for Gene Delivery: Principles and methods for creating nanoparticle-based gene delivery systems.
โ€ข Nanomedicine Applications in Genetic Disorders: Analysis of nanomedicine's role in treating genetic diseases, such as cystic fibrosis and hemophilia.
โ€ข Genetic Nanomedicine in Cancer Therapy: Exploration of nanoparticle-based gene therapies for treating various types of cancer.
โ€ข Clinical Trials and Regulations: Examination of regulatory frameworks and ethical considerations for genetic nanomedicine.
โ€ข Emerging Trends in Genetic Nanomedicine: Discussion of cutting-edge research and future directions in genetic nanomedicine innovations.

The Masterclass Certificate in Genetic Nanomedicine Innovations equips learners with the skills to excel in the rapidly evolving field of nanomedicine and gene therapy. Here are some roles in this exciting industry, represented through a 3D pie chart, highlighting their relevance based on job market trends and demand in the UK: 1. **Gene Therapy Specialist**: With a 45% share, gene therapy specialists focus on replacing, manipulating, or supplementing non-functional genes responsible for causing diseases. Their expertise is crucial for developing targeted treatment options and improving patients' lives. 2. **Nanomedicine Engineer**: Representing a 26% share, nanomedicine engineers design, build, and test nanoscale devices to diagnose and treat diseases. Their role is vital for creating innovative medical solutions and advancing healthcare technologies. 3. **Genetic Research Scientist**: Claiming a 15% share, genetic research scientists conduct lab experiments to study genes and molecular mechanisms. They contribute to a better understanding of genetic disorders and develop novel therapeutic strategies. 4. **Bioinformatics Engineer**: With a 14% share, bioinformatics engineers combine computer science, biology, and statistics to analyze and interpret complex genetic data. They play a significant role in the development of personalized medicine and genomic testing.
